Heating season: Naftogaz talked about plans to replenish underground gas storages

In November, there should be up to 15 billion cubic meters in storage.

Ukraine plans to accumulate gas reserves by November 2022 in underground storage facilities (PSG) at the level of 14.4-15 billion cubic meters. This was announced by the head of Naftogaz Ukrainy JSC Yury Vitrenko on the air of the telethon, Interfax-Ukraine reports. .4 billion cubic meters to 15 billion cubic meters,” Vitrenko said.

We remind you that as of the beginning of August, gas reserves in Ukrainian storages exceeded 12 billion cubic meters, and 1.83 million were accumulated in TPP and CHP warehouses tons of coal from the planned 2.5 million tons.
